Receiving documents

Receiving documents in Fax Only Mode ________

When the FAXPHONE is set up for a dedicated line, it automatically receives documents whenever a call comes over the fax line.

The FAXPHONE cannot receive automatically if you are making copies, printing reports, or registering information. See p. 68.

1 Press [RECEIVE MODE] until “Fax Only Mode”

 

appears on the LCD.

Fax Only Mode

2 Press [START/COPY].

09/15/97 FaxOnly

The FAXPHONE assumes all incoming calls are from another fax machine sending a document. It receives the documents automatically.

Receiving documents in Fax/Tel Mode __________

6

You can set the FAXPHONE to monitor all incoming calls over the fax/telephone line. When the FAXPHONE receives an incoming call, it checks to see if the call is from another fax machine trying to send a document or from someone wanting to talk to you. You need to have an extension phone connected to your FAXPHONE for this mode. See p. 13.

The FAXPHONE cannot receive automatically if you are making copies, printing reports, or registering information. See p. 68.

1 Make sure you have connected an extension phone to your FAXPHONE. See p. 13.

2 Press [RECEIVE MODE] until “Fax/Tel Mode”

 

appears on the LCD.

Fax/Tel Mode

3 Press [START/COPY].

09/15/97 Fax/Tel

When the FAXPHONE receives a call, it checks to see whether the call is from another fax machine or from a telephone.

If the INCOMING RING function is set to OFF, the FAXPHONE does not ring (even if an extension phone is connected) when it receives a call from another fax machine that is trying to send a document. This is so that you are not disturbed when your FAXPHONE is communicating with another fax machine. The FAXPHONE automatically receives the document.

In Fax Only Mode or Fax/Tel Mode, if you want the extension phone to ring to make sure that someone is sending you a document, you need to set INCOMING RING to ON and connect an extension phone.

If the call is from a person, the FAXPHONE rings to alert you to pick up the exten- sion phone.

If you do not pick up the handset of the extension phone within 15 seconds, the FAXPHONE stops ringing. It checks again to make sure the call is not from a fax

machine and then hangs up.
